Across the available record, Big Mommas Hickory Smoked BBQ has nine inspections on file, the first dated 2022. The most recent report on file is from Jan 13, 2026. Diners should read medium risk as a signal that some issues exist but aren't extreme.

The trend has not been favorable: recent inspections average around six violations each, up from closer to three violations before.

When inspectors have written things up, “raw animal food stored over/not properly separated” has been the most frequent reason, cited two times.

Compared to other Palm Harbor restaurants (averaging 74), there's room to close the gap. The record is unremarkable in either direction.
